
PICTORIAL, VIDEO: DABIRI-EREWA HONOURED IN THE KINGDOM OF SAUDI ARABIA
Abuja, April 7, 2025: Hon. Abike Dabiri-Erewa, Chairman/CEO of the Nigerians in Diaspora Commission (NIDCOM), has been awarded another doctorate degree by Smart Island University in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ia in recognition of her humanitarian services and pioneering efforts in diaspora development.
The award was presented to her in Saudi Arabia by the University’s Registrar, Dr. Mohammed Dhaidan Al-Mutairi, who praised her diligence and persistence. He explained that the honor was given to her for her significant contributions to humanitarian and diaspora affairs.
The Registrar also noted that the university currently has almost 90 Nigerian students enrolled in various programs. He acknowledged her efforts in advancing diaspora relations and other humanitarian initiatives and expressed the university’s intention to deepen its relationship with Nigeria, including the potential establishment of a campus in the country.
In receiving the award, Hon. Abike Dabiri-Erewa thanked the institution for conferring the doctorate degree on her and expressed her appreciation to the Association of Nigerians in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ia for their role in mobilizing Nigerians to project the positive image of the country.
A date for the formal conferment will be announced later in the year.
